Hi, My daughter is 4 years and 8 months old height 114 CM and weight 16.5 . how can increase her weight.

A. Give her something to eat in every 3 hours like poha, idli, upma, semolina, suji kakara(odisha desert)and rice dal veg / fish in lunch and roti at night. You can also give home made chhena, ladu , sattu/ chatua ,paneer, chilla and spicy chatpata chana rajma salad. but don't give her packet juice packed biscuits which are available in market very easily.
